Section 39(4)
Any reference in this Chapter, in relation to the abstraction of water or obstructing or impeding the flow of any inland waters by means of impounding works, to derogating from a right which is a protected right for the purposes of this Chapter is a reference to, as the case may be— in such a way, or to such an extent, as to prevent the person entitled to that right from abstracting water to the extent mentioned in (as the case may be) section 39A(2) or (7), 48(1) or 59C(10) below or section 102(3) of the Water Act 2003, or in a provision made in an order by virtue of section 10(5)(b) of that Act, in each case subject to any limitations mentioned there. abstracting water; or so obstructing or impeding the flow of any such waters,
